2011 Soliste L’Espérance Sonoma Coast Pinot Noir

12.8% alc., 104 cases, $75. 100% clone 115 from Sonatera Vineyard. · Moderately light reddish-purple color in the glass. Wonderful aromatic presence with scents of black cherry, spice, and sous-bois. The nose really picks up intensity and interest over time in the glass. Enticing flavors of black cherry, spiced plum and black raspberry with an earthy, savory undertone. Very silky in the mouth with comforting elegance, a soft tannic backbone, and some finishing persistence. Better the following day from a previously opened and recorked bottle and still solid two days later. This wine will benefit from further cellaring but is hard to resist now. Drink the more forward 2011 L’Ambroise while this one mellows in the cellar. Score: 94. Reviewed December 30, 2013
